Château de Pressac is magnificently situated on the coteaux in Saint-Emilion. Part of it dates from the 13th century. It was at Château de Pressac that the treaty was signed after the battle of Castillon which put an end to the Hundred Years War. Mr and Mrs Quenin took over the property in 1997 and began major renovations. To recreate the vineyard on the steep slopes as they were at the beginning of the 20th century, they have not hesitated to cut curved, level terraces into the hills, as for the cellars.
